Police exercise on tight security

Hyderabad, November 16 (Press media of india): The nomination period for assembly elections is over. Contesting candidates are ramping up their campaign. Henceforth the election campaign will intensify. The leadership of the respective parties focused on campaigning in the capital city. With the campaigns and road shows of BRS, Congress, BJP and MIM leaders, the political buzz in the city is going to increase. As the election heats up, there is a possibility of disputes between the respective parties. It is in this background that the police are increasing the security by considering all the matters. Central forces have already reached the city. As part of the five state elections going on across the country, the first phase of the elections was held in Chhattisgarh on November 7. The second phase is being held on the 17th. Also, the first round of elections will be held in Madhya Pradesh on 17th. Elections in Telangana will be held on November 30. As a result of the completion of the elections in the respective states, the central forces are coming to Telangana in stages. Meanwhile, top leaders of all parties are coming to the city to organize campaigns and roadshows. The police officers of Tri Police Commissionerates are preparing a special action on this. Huge arrangements are being made for roadshows and meetings. Precautionary measures are being taken to avoid any untoward incident. Precautionary measures are being taken to prevent disruption of peace and order in the peaceful old town.

Strong vigilance on cash smuggling:
Rachakonda CP held a coordination meeting on Wednesday with District Expenditure Supervisors and Election Officers on the measures taken in Yadadri Bhuvanagiri district since the beginning of CP election notification process. On this occasion, security measures taken since the notification was issued, checkpoints, illegal cash, liquor and drug smuggling cases were discussed. Officials of other departments who participated in this meeting explained about the programs undertaken on behalf of their department. On this occasion, CP Chauhan said that check posts have been set up at all necessary places in Rachakonda and armed checks are being carried out. He said that CC cameras have also been installed in the inspection areas. Illegal money, liquor and other items are being seized in the presence of the Executive Magistrate. Bhuvanagiri Zone DCP Rajesh Chandra, IAS Officer Kondiga Hanumanth, IPS Vipul Kumar and others participated in this meeting.

CP DS Chauhan inspected the check posts
Rachakonda Police Commissioner DS Chauhan inspected the election security and staff performance at the check posts. On Wednesday, he visited the Kothaguda check post under the Greater Amberpet Police Station. Inquired about the security arrangements there. The staff were made aware of the precautions to be taken in the wake of the elections and the matters related to vehicle inspections. The CP explained that all necessary security measures are being taken for the smooth conduct of the elections. He said that more check posts will be set up wherever necessary and strong surveillance has been set up to stop illegal cash and liquor.

Extensive inspections..Rs 3.58 crore cash seizure
In the wake of Assembly elections, extensive inspections are going on across Hyderabad district. A huge amount of cash and illegal liquor are being seized during these checks. As part of the election code of conduct, Rs 1,15,000 was caught by flying scud in one day on Wednesday. Election Officer Ronald Ross said that Rs.3,58,47,450 cash has been seized so far. Apart from this, it is stated that Rs 49,50,20,372 cash has been seized by the police authority. He said that 727 FIRs have been registered. 3150 Nakkas operations, two cases have been registered under election code of conduct violation.(PMI)
